Dela via


Ändra utgivningskanaler för modellbaserade appar

Utgivningskanal påverkar funktionerna som påverkar användarna. När månadskanal har aktiverats för en miljö måste utvecklare verifiera att deras anpassningar fungerar med varje månadsutgivning. I den här artikeln beskrivs olika metoder för en tillverkare att byta kanal och validera en kommande utgåva.

Flexibel kanalkonfiguration

Utgivningskanal för modellbaserade appar kan ändras på två huvudsakliga sätt.

  • Appkanal (börjar med version 23111)
  • Miljökanal

Dessutom kan utgivningskanal åsidosättas med något av dessa alternativ.

Anteckning

När utgivningskanal ändras på miljönivå måste användaren uppdatera webbläsarens flik två gånger för att uppdatera informationen om utgivningskanal. Den första uppdateringen utlöser en bakgrundsuppdatering av funktionskonfigurationen till ett lokalt cacheminne. Den andra uppdateringen använder det lokala cacheminnet för funktionens konfiguration.

Ändrar miljökanalen

Miljökanalen kan anges med Power Platform administrationscenter eller med kod.

Power Platform administratörer kan ändra utgivningskanal med hjälp av miljöns funktionsinställningar. Mer information: Hantera funktionsinställningar.

Utvecklare kan ändra miljökanal genom att uppdatera kolumnvärdet ReleaseChannel för raden i tabellen Organisation. Det finns alltid en enskild rad i organisationstabellen. Mer information:

Ändrar appkanalen

Appkanal kan användas för att åsidosätta utgivningskanal för en modellbaserad app med hjälp av området Power Apps appdesigner eller lösningsområdet.

Appens lanseringskanal Appens inställningsvärde Funktionssätt
Automatiskt 0 Standardvärdet för appen är Halvår, men kommer senare att ändras till Månadsvis i en kommande version.
Månadsvis 1 Appen har uttryckligen angetts till Månatlig kanal.
Halvårsvis 3 Appen har uttryckligen angetts till Halvårskanal.

Anteckning

Programversionsvärde 2 används för intern testning och erhåller uppdateringar snabbare än månatlig kanal, så det stöds inte för produktionsanvändning.

Byt appkanal i appdesignern

En utvecklare kan använda appdesignern för att uttryckligen ange utgivningskanal för en app, som åsidosätter miljökanal.

  1. Öppna https://make.powerapps.com/.

  2. Under Lösningar öppnar en befintlig lösning som innehåller en modellbaserad app.

  3. Öppna appen i appdesigner.

  4. Öppna dialogrutan Inställningar.

  5. Under fliken Allmänt, expandera Avancerade inställningar.

  6. Använd Appens utgivningskanal och ändra värdet för appens utgivning. Mer information finns i: Ändra appkanal

    Inställningar av appdesigner, lanseringskanal för appar

  7. Spara och publicera programmet.

Byt appkanal i lösningsområdet

En utvecklare kan använda området Lösningar för att uttryckligen ange utgivningskanal för flera appar eller alla appar i miljön.

Redigera app för lösningsutforskaren och inställning för appkanal

  1. Öppna https://make.powerapps.com/
  2. Under Lösningar öppnar en befintlig lösning med en eller flera modellbaserade appar:
  3. Lägg till den befintliga appinställningen Tillåt att den nya appkanalstandarden används i lösningen:
    1. Välj Lägg till befintligt > Mer > Inställning.
    2. Sök efter en appkanal.
    3. Välj objektets Appkanal.
    4. Markera Lägga till.
  4. Så här ändrar du appkanal för flera appar:
    1. Redigera inställningen Appkanal.
    2. Hitta apparna under avsnittet Ange appvärden.
    3. Välj Nytt appvärde och ange sedan heltal för kanalen.
    4. Välj Spara.
  5. Så här ändrar du appkanal för alla appar i miljön:
    1. Redigera inställningen Appkanal.
    2. Hitta avsnittet Miljövärde för inställning.
    3. Välj Nytt miljövärde och ange sedan heltal för kanalen.
    4. Välj Spara.
  6. När du har ändrat en appinställning för specifika appar måste apparna publiceras på nytt för att ändringen ska få effekt.

Ange standardvärdet för nya appar till månadskanal

Som en del av migreringen till standardmigrering av alla appar som ska använda månadskanal kommer nyskapade modellbaserade appar att börja se standardinställningen för appkanal. Administratörer och utvecklare kan styra standardinställningen för nya appar med hjälp av en appinställning. Appinställningen Tillåt ny appkanal som standard ställs in på Ja, vilket innebär att en nyskapad app har angetts till Månad.

Förhindra ny app som standard till månadskanal

Den nya appstandarden kan förhindras genom att byta Tillåt ny appkanal som standard till Nej. Detta gör att den nya appen skapas med utgivningskanalens värde Automatiskt.

I följande steg ändras standardinställningen för alla nya appar i en miljö. Den här appinställningen åsidosätter kan också läggas i en lösning som migrerats till alla miljöer för att förhindra att nya appar får en standarduppsättning.

  1. Gå till Lösningar och öppna en befintlig eller skapa en ny lösning.
  2. Lägg till den befintliga appinställningen Tillåt att den nya appkanalstandarden används i lösningen:
    1. Välj Lägg till befintligt > Mer > Inställning.
    2. Sök efter en appkanalstandard.
    3. Markera objektet Tillåt att den nya appkanalstandarden.
    4. Markera Lägga till.
  3. Redigera inställningen Tillåt att den nya appkanalstandarden:
    1. Markera Tillåt att den nya appkanalstandarden.
    2. Välj Nytt miljövärde.
    3. Ändra miljövärdet till Nej.
    4. Välj Spara.

Ändrar användarkanalen

Användarkanal kan användas för att åsidosätta både miljökanal och appkanal via Power Platform administrationscenter eller med kod.

Power Platform administratörer kan ändra utgivningskanal med hjälp av inställningarna i miljöns användarlista. Mer information: Hantera åsidosättande av användarkanal.

Utvecklare kan ändra användarens utgivningskanal genom att uppdatera kolumnvärdet ReleaseChannel för raden i tabellen UserSettings. Användarkanal kan uppdateras programmässigt med samma metod som miljökanal.

Ändra kanal för webbläsarsession

Du kan ändra en enskild webbläsarsession genom att lägga till URL-parametern &channel=<channelname> som ett tillfälligt åsidosättande. URL-parametern används för all navigering på fliken i webbläsaren. Den kanske inte kopieras till en ny flik i webbläsaren.

Kanal URL-parameter
Halvårsvis &channel=semiannual
Månadsvis &channel=monthly

Om kanalen är månadsvis kan månadsutgivningen ändras med hjälp av URL-parametern &channelrelease=<releasename>. Formatet utgivningsnamn tvåsiffrigt år och tvåsiffrigt månad, som ÅÅMM. Dessutom kan nästa månatliga utgivning anges med &channelrelease=next.

Månadsutgivning Parameternamn för utgivning
Oktober 2023 &channelrelease=2310
November 2023 &channelrelease=2311
December 2023 &channelrelease=2312
Januari 2024 &channelrelease=2401

Anteckning

Val giltigt YYMM-version kan anges men eventuella funktioner har eventuellt inte definierats för framtida datum.

Validera nästa månatliga utgivning

Valideringen bör göras för varje månatlig kanalutgivning innan den aktiveras automatiskt för användarna. Användarna kan testa när validering av versionen har nått miljön.

Det enklaste sättet att validera är genom att lägga till &channelrelease=next som automatiskt ställer in utgivningskanalen till nästa kommande månadsutgivning.

  1. Hitta den aktuella månaden med en modellbaserad app genom att välja Inställningar > Om. Utgivningsversionen följer Kanal: Månadsvis och är ett datum som juli 2023.

  2. Lägg till &channelrelease=next i URL:en.

  3. Upprepa det första steget och observera en uppdaterad version.

Följande steg kan användas för att validera för en specifik månadsutgivning:

  1. Hitta den aktuella månaden med en modellbaserad app genom att välja Inställningar > Om. Utgivningsversionen följer Kanal: Månadsvis och är ett datum som juli 2023.

  2. Hitta korta namn för månatliga utgivningen genom att öppna Enhetligt gränssnitt månatlig kanalutgivning.

  3. En specifik utgåva kan anges med URL-parametern ''&channelrelease='' med nästa korta namn, t.ex. 2308.

Jämföra funktioner mellan kanaler och utgivningar

När en användare som kör en månatlig kanal observerar ett oväntat beteende kan följande steg hjälpa dig att undersöka vad som har inträffat.

  • Kontrollera om det oväntade beteendet finns i halvårskanalen med hjälp av URL-parametern &channel=semiannual. Om funktionen även finns i halvårskanalen är den inte kopplad till månadskanalen och bör följa normala supportprocesser.
  • Kontrollera om det oväntade beteendet finns i den föregående månaden med hjälp av URL-parametern &channelrelease= med det korta namnet för utgivningen, t,ex. 2308. Om de två månadsutgivningarna fungerar på samma sätt är det troligen inte relaterat till en viss månatlig kanalutgivning och bör följa normala supportprocesser.
  • När du märker en förändring mellan månatliga utgivningar kan du läsa de ändrade funktionerna i Enhetligt gränssnitt för månatlig kanalutgivning för mer information.

Se även

Översikt över utgivningskanal
Användare om dialog – kanal
Power Platform administrationscenter – hantera beteendeinställningar
Power Platform administrationscenter – Hantera åsidosättning av användarkanal.